.Yesterday’s Past.
In a small, quiet town so cozy and bright,
Where dwarfs live happy in homes just right,
The houses all gleam with rooftops of green,
A sight so special, simple, serene.

Children still play in the open air,
A joy that’s fading, now so rare.
Neighbors talk, kids laugh, and say hello,
As the sky above puts on a vibrant show.

But why aren’t people smiling more?
Why the distance, the closed-off doors?
Is it the TV, the screens that glow,
The gadgets that claim all we know.

Autumn nears, and leaves will fall,
Orange, yellow, and green in it all,
Yet the green rooftops will proudly stay,
A reminder of life that won’t decay.

Driving down roads through leafy scenes,
I think of the past and what it means.
Like leaves, we too must shed and renew,
To rise again, fresh and true.

So take a drive, take a glance,
Notice what’s missing in a fleeting chance.
Just like expansion, there’s more to see,
In moments unnoticed, life’s mystery.

As fall arrives and leaves descend,
Beauty surrounds us, without end.
Yet people stay in, doors remain closed,
Even Halloween nights no longer glow.

Winter comes, the snow falls down,
But children are nowhere to be found.
So step outside, be bold and free,
Lie on the grass or snow and see.

Embrace the moment, cherish today,
For life is short, it won’t delay.
Don’t live with regrets, let go of the past,
For today’s the day—make memories that last.

The End
